Français : Église de Montricher. Son clocher était l'ancienne chapelle du château, il est le seul qui soit rond dans le canton de Vaud. À l'origine c'était une ancienne tour, à l’angle nord-est de l'enceinte du château construit avant 1049 par Rodolphe de Grandson. Tour transformée en chapelle (probablement dédiée à Saint-Nicolas), puis en clocher.
English: Fortification tower in the north-east corner of the ancient Montricher castle, built before 1049 by Lord Rodolphe de Grandson transformed into a bell tower for the chapel that was presumably dedicated to Saint Nicholas.
